trynix: 13 years of Nix history in one browser tab
A browser-based Nix package explorer that boots historical nixpkgs packages inside a local QEMU virtual machine.

Field notes
trynix resolves package specifications against a 13-year nixpkgs history, fetches their closures from binary caches, and places the results in a browser-run x86_64 Linux VM. QEMU is compiled to WebAssembly, while extra caches can be supplied with a URL and public key; the page says signatures are checked during closure traversal. Packages need not have coexisted in one nixpkgs release, allowing combinations such as historical Python and newer tools.
